WebNov 5, 2010 · it must be received by the TSP on or before the date of your death. Only a Form TSP-3 is valid for designating beneficiaries to your TSP account(s); a will or court order (i.e., divorce decree) is not valid for the disposition of a TSP account. You may, however, designate your estate or a trust as a beneficiary on Form TSP-3.
